What is Chime?

Chime states that it is a financial technology company founded on the premise that basic banking services should be helpful, easy, and free. The company claims that it wants to profit from its members, not from them. That’s why their model doesn’t rely on an overdraft, monthly service, minimum balance, or other consumer fees.

Chime partners with regional banks to design member first financial products. This is aimed to create a more competitive market with better, lower-cost options for everyday Americans who aren’t being served well by traditional banks. Chime promises to drive innovation, inclusion, and access across the online banking industry with alternative solutions.

Chime claims that you get many exclusive features you cannot get with traditional banking platforms. You get to enjoy features like no hidden fees or charges, no overdraft fees(up to $200) get paid early with direct deposits, 60,000+ fee-free ATMs at the stores you love, and more.

Chime also has a mobile app for both mobile device platforms Android and iOS. And its app is an award-winning mobile app that has everything you need with a simple and intuitive design. it also boasts more than 135000 five-star reviews on app stores.

Ever since Chime began its operation, it advertised itself as an alternative online bank. But in reality, it is not an actual bank but a financial technology company that provides banking services using its partner banks i.e. Stride Bank and The Bancorp Bank. These banks are responsible for handling all of the banking transactions that take place on behalf of Chime.

Since Chime is not really a bank it has had problems with the law and authorities. It was discovered that when its computer systems faced an outage, the company was describing itself as a bank, in violation of state law in California.

So in May 2021, Chime was forced to stop using the term “bank”  in advertisements according to complaints by the California Department of Financial Protection and Innovation.

The most controversial thing about Chime is the way that the company has closed the accounts of its customers without any prior notice or explanation. The company attributed this as an accidental outcome of fraud prevention tactics deployed by Chime. And on top of customers losing their accounts, some of them were even denied the money in their accounts. Some customers claimed that they were denied of balance in thousands of dollars which were outright unfair and illegal.

Even though Chime is a relatively small company compared to other banking giants like Wells Fargo, it seems to have received quite a lot of complaints from its customers. And when Chime tried to solve such issues, it was a slow and painful process. Even though some issues were solved, some remained unsolved for a long time and some didn’t even receive a factual reason behind their account closure. From the complaints filed against the company, many were because of accounts being closed against the customer’s will. And many of the complaints were found to be mislabeled or labeled inconsistently as well.

What happens when you delete your Chime account?

When you delete your Chime account you will lose all your data associated with your account permanently. You will no longer be able to access the payment features through the Chime app on your phone and you will lose all the exclusive features that you used to get. And the Chime Visa Debit Card will also no longer be valid for payments after you have deleted your account. You will no longer be able to make any payments using the Chime app or the Chime Visa Debit Card anymore.

Other users will no longer be able to send money to your account either. And the transactions that were connected to your Chime account will no longer be valid like your subscriptions or recurring payments on third-party sites for the services that you had previously signed up for.

If you want to use Chime again you will have to create a new account and set up everything from the beginning. And you don’t need to worry about your credit score being affected if you don’t have a negative rating or balance on your account.

Delete Chime account via phone

Alternatively, you can directly contact Chime’s Customer Service via phone at 1-844-244-6363  between 7 am and 9 pm on all days of the week and request the support staff to cancel or delete your account.

How to appeal for an account deactivated by Chime? 

If your account got disabled or deactivated by Chime, you might have been suspected of fraudulent activity on your account by Chime’s anti-fraud system. If you didn’t do anything wrong you can contact Chime’s Customer Support via email at  support@chime.com or you can directly give them a call at 1-844-244-6363 between 7 am and 9 pm on all days of the week to sort out the issue.

Email support might be slow, so you might have to wait for some time before you get a reply from a support representative looking into your issue. If your issue is urgent you might be better off giving them a call.

How to stop receiving notifications from Chime?

After deleting your account, all push notifications from the Chime app will stop completely but Chime will send you email notifications about new events and promotions even after deleting your account. If you want to stop receiving all email notifications from Chime you can choose to unsubscribe from all email notifications from Chime completely.

To do this just go to your email associated with your Chime account, go to your inbox, find an email from Chime, scroll to the bottom of the page and click on Unsubscribe and confirm if it asks you to. This will mute all future email notifications from Chime from now on.
